当在 Emacs 中修改文件时,会在工作目录中创建一个临时文件,如下所示:.#filename
。保存缓冲区时文件将被删除。
我在 Git 远程存储库中发现了一些此类临时文件,我认为最好从源头上消灭萌芽,而不是将 Git 配置为在每个项目中忽略它们。
我们如何配置 Emacs 以在/tmp
目录而不是工作目录?
有问题的文件称为lockfile -- 从 Emacs 版本 24.3 开始,可以通过以下设置进行控制:
(setq create-lockfiles nil)
https://stackoverflow.com/a/12974060/2112489 https://stackoverflow.com/a/12974060/2112489
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)